This Date in Country Music History

  • 2023 – Taylor Swift‘s “Speak Now (Taylor’s Version)” topped the Billboard country albums chart
  • 2020 – Dustin Lynch‘s single “Ridin’ Roads” was certified Platinum
  • 2020 – Blake Shelton‘s single “God’s Country” was certified Triple Platinum
  • 2020 – The Blake Shelton/Gwen Stefani duet “Nobody But You” was certified Platinum
  • 2020 – Chase Rice‘s single “Eyes On You” was certified Double Platinum
  • 2020 – Dan + Shay‘s single “All to Myself” was certified Double Platinum
  • 2020 – Kenny Chesney‘s single “Get Along’ was certified Double Platinum
  • 2014 – The Cadillac Three made their Grand Ole Opry debut
  • 2014 – Jason Aldean released his single “Burnin’ It Down”
  • 2008 – Sugarland released their Love on the Inside album
  • 2006 – Brad Paisley scored a #1 hit with “The World”
  • 2003 – Brian McComas released his self-titled debut album
  • 2003 – Brad Paisley‘s Mud on the Tires album was released
  • 1995 – Shania Twain scored her first career #1 hit with “Any Man of Mine”
  • 1989 – George Strait topped the charts with his single “What’s Going On In Your World”
  • 1977 – Kenny Rogers released his Daytime Friends album
  • 1968 – Merle Haggard released his single “Mama Tried”
